How far away was the Britannica from the titanic when it crashed?

There was no ship called Britannica in the Atlantic during the sinking of Titanic. There was Britannic, which was one of it's sister ships, but it didn't actually set sail until 1914. There was also a Britannic that was built in 1929 and there was Britannia that was built in 1840 and decommissioned in 1880. You may be thinking of the Californian, which was within 20 miles of the Titanic at the time of its sinking. However, they did not go to her aid.

Who was Ruth becker?

Ruth Becker was aboard the Titanic and she had 2 siblings Richard whom was 1 years old and Marion whom was 4 years old aboard the Titanic. Her mom was Nellie Becker and was 35 when aboard the Titanic. They all survived the sinking of the Titanic .
